Manchester United legend's son set to earn ₦92 million per year at Old Trafford
The famous Manchester United Rooney name could soon be back on a long-term contract at Old Trafford.
Kai Rooney, son of Manchester United icon Wayne Rooney, is on the verge of securing a new deal with the club as his rise through the academy continues to gather momentum.
United reward Kai Rooney’s academy progress
Manchester United have reportedly offered Kai Rooney a new scholarship deal that could see the 16-year-old earn around ₦92 million per year, equivalent to £50,000 annually.
The forward, who finishes school in the summer, has spent several years in United’s academy and is said to have impressed coaches with his development and attitude.
According to reports, Kai is part of a “very strong” group of 14 youngsters being lined up for new deals, underlining how highly the club rates the current crop of academy talent.
The scholarship is expected to be offered either during the summer or just before the start of the new season, with the possibility of it later converting into a professional contract if his progress continues.
The Rooney family are understood to be considering the offer, which would also include an annual signing-on fee, as Kai looks to take the next major step in his football journey.
A special Old Trafford moment and famous footsteps to follow
Kai recently enjoyed a memorable milestone under the lights at Old Trafford, featuring in the FA Youth Cup after overcoming injury setbacks.
Wearing the famous Rooney name, he received a huge ovation from the crowd when introduced, with chants ringing around the stadium as his proud parents, Wayne and Coleen, watched on from the stands.
The moment carried extra symbolism, with former United midfielder Michael Carrick also present, highlighting the club’s belief in the importance of youth development.
For Kai Rooney, the path ahead is demanding, but the opportunity to follow in his father’s legendary footsteps at Manchester United is now very real.
